Peter & Kennedy Burn Brightly

Daughter of Elusive Fort is consistency personified

The Elusive Fort filly Big Burn surprised even some of her staunchest supporters when she maintained her excellent form with a courageous victory under top weight to win the R200 000 Gr3 Sycamore Sprint  run over 1160m at Turffontein on Saturday.

The high-riding combination of Turffontein trainer Paul Peter and jockey Warren Kennedy lauded the Narrow Creek Stud-bred 3yo, who produced what is probably her finest performance to date.

Giving kilo’s to some decent older fillies, Big Burn (3-1) cruised a length off the pace before galloping powerfully into the lead at the 300m, drawing clear to beat Kissing Point (10-1) who was receiving 9 kgs, by 2 lengths in a time of 65,85 secs.

Warren Kennedy steers Big Burn ahead of Kabelo Matsunyane and Kissing Point (Pic- JC Photos)

Sean Tarry’s Full Velocity (28-10) stayed on for third, a further 1,25 lengths back.

“She’s small of stature, but big of heart,” said Kennedy, who thanked owners Arun Chadha, Ian Levitan and Warne Rippon.

Trainer Paul Peter is within touching distance of Justin Snaith at the top of the national trainer’s log,  and the yard had another three winners on the day.

“I am a bit worried – Mr Arun Chadha thinks this is an easy game. He is just such a lucky owner!” laughed Peter.

Big Burn’s Groom Elias ‘Rasta’ Radebe, who apparently does a great cover of Canadian singer ‘The Weeknd’, received a mention as a key player in the Big Burn success story.

A daughter of Elusive Fort (Fort Wood), Big Burn is out of the once winning Argonaut mare, Ignition Lady.

The winner cost R300 000 at the BSA National 2yo Sale and took her career tally on Saturday to 5 wins and 4 places from 9 starts for earnings of R751 750.

She must surely have aspirations of a Gr1 strike this term – the SA Fillies Sprint run over 1200m at Hollywoodbets Scottsville on 4 June could be a target.
